Aluminum CNC: Mastering the Material
Successfully machining components from aluminum alloy via CNC requires a complete understanding of its unique properties . Its tendency to seize to machining requires careful choice of coolants and correct cutters. In addition, managing chip evacuation and preventing work hardening are critical to securing high-quality components and optimizing machining efficiency.
